> I am trying to get the individual words from a column in a table I
> have indexed to make it searchable from InterMedia Text. This is the
> set of words which would give at least one row in a search result set.
>
> Is this possible? I cannot find a select clause/syntax that will dump
> out the index term values.

Check with the DBA: what languague option was installed? Assuming US
English (The default)
Check with the programmer: what stoplist was used when the index was
created (Assuming the default, a.k.a none specified)
Check the scripts: all words NOT in the stoplist should be indexed.
Still leaves your question, which puzzles me - 'a set which would give
at least one row in a search result set'?
Any word not in the stoplist, I'd say.
Are you using the contains syntax as required?
